πŸ”— Quick Answer

Modern meeting tools offer extensive integration capabilities through REST APIs, webhooks, and pre-built connectors. Key integrations include CRM systems (Salesforce, HubSpot), project management tools (Asana, Notion), communication platforms (Slack, Teams), and custom workflows via automation platforms like Zapier and Make.

⚠️ Common Integration Challenges

Data Mapping Issues

Misaligned field structures between systems

Create comprehensive data mapping documentation and use transformation tools

Rate Limiting

API requests exceeding platform limits

Implement request throttling and batch processing strategies

Authentication Failures

Token expiration and permission issues

Set up automatic token refresh and proper permission scopes

Error Handling

Failed integrations without proper notification

Implement comprehensive logging and alert systems

πŸ’‘ Integration Best Practices

βœ… Do's

  • βœ“
    Start with simple workflows

    Begin with basic automations before building complex integrations

  • βœ“
    Document everything

    Maintain clear documentation for all integration configurations

  • βœ“
    Test thoroughly

    Use staging environments before production deployment

  • βœ“
    Monitor performance

    Set up metrics and alerts for integration health

❌ Don'ts

  • βœ—
    Over-engineer solutions

    Avoid complex integrations when simple ones suffice

  • βœ—
    Ignore security

    Never compromise on authentication and data protection

  • βœ—
    Skip error handling

    Always plan for integration failures and data inconsistencies

  • βœ—
    Hard-code values

    Use configuration files for all integration settings
